Transaction 71afe6d2eebcb6fdc26fe8cd9f37a28fced49c7606771e81ad5a69a33c26397e

1 Input
2 Outputs
  • 71afe6d2eebcb6fdc26fe8cd9f37a28fced49c7606771e81ad5a69a33c26397e:0
  • value  5344493802
    address  3AbjYLrDJCygQJjiAqqU7V3dvbntHGKu2Q
  • 71afe6d2eebcb6fdc26fe8cd9f37a28fced49c7606771e81ad5a69a33c26397e:1
  • value  7728811
    address  32bxj1yt6Z4uyJpZ2hR1SQPFMS41CpkSXz